Etymology

Ultimately from Middle Chinese compound 殲滅 (MC tziɛm mjiet, literally “annihilate + destroy”), probably as a learned borrowing from Chinese 殲滅歼灭 (jiānmiè).

First cited to a text from 1825.[1]

Noun

(せん)(めつ) (senmetsu) 

  1. [from 1825] annihilation, eradication, extermination

Usage notes

Often spelled せん滅 due to the rarity and complexity of the first character .
